CAST XFP 32 ZONE ANALOGUE ADDRESSABLE FIRE ALARM PANEL
NETWORK FUNCTIONS (OPTIONAL)
This menu function allows you to configure the panel to be part of a non-redundant network of up to
eight CAST XFP main panels, OR allow it to have up to eight XFP repeaters connected to it. This option
is only available if you have a network driver card fitted at the panel (see pages 13 & 14 for an overview
of networking). The NETWORK FUNCTIONS menu has three options detailed below. Additional options
are set using the panel's PC programming tools.
SET COMMS FUNCTION
This function MUST be used to set the panel's RS485 comms to operate in Network or Repeater mode.
Enter AL3 (4444) > Network Functions > Set Comms Function.

SET PANEL NUMBER
If networking CAST XFP main panels, this function MUST be used to give each panel a unique ID number
(1 to 8) so it can be recognised by other networked panels.
Note: Repeaters do not need to be assigned an ID number.
Enter AL3 (4444) > Network Functions > Set Panel Number.

SET PANEL FITTED
This function allows you to turn off the fault monitoring of non-redundant networked CAST XFP main
panels. Typically, it is used if maintenance work is to be carried out at a networked panel to temporarily
prevent integrity faults being flagged.
Enter AL3 (4444) > Network Functions > Set Panel Fitted.
